La sobrecarga es un concepto de programación que se refiere a la capacidad de definir múltiples métodos con el mismo nombre pero con diferentes firmas. Esto permite una mayor flexibilidad a la hora de diseñar clases y métodos, ya que permite invocar métodos con diferentes tipos de argumentos. La sobrecarga puede usarse para crear métodos que realicen la misma funcionalidad pero con diferentes tipos de argumentos, o para crear métodos que realicen diferentes funcionalidades dependiendo del tipo de argumentos pasados.
¿Qué es la sobrecarga de funciones?
La sobrecarga de funciones es la capacidad de crear múltiples funciones con el mismo nombre que realizan diferentes tareas. Esto se consigue a menudo pasando diferentes tipos o números de argumentos a la función. La sobrecarga de funciones puede ser una herramienta útil para crear un código más conciso y legible.
¿Qué es la sobrecarga en C++? La sobrecarga en C++ se refiere a la capacidad de crear múltiples funciones con el mismo nombre, siempre y cuando tengan diferentes firmas. Esto puede ser útil cuando se quiere proporcionar una funcionalidad diferente dependiendo de los parámetros de entrada. Por ejemplo, puedes crear una función sobrecargada que se comporte de forma diferente dependiendo de si la entrada es un int o un double.
¿Qué es la sobrecarga y el ejemplo?
La sobrecarga es el concepto de tener múltiples métodos con el mismo nombre pero diferentes firmas. Esto permite una mayor flexibilidad y una más fácil reutilización del código. Por ejemplo, usted podría tener un método que toma un entero y otro método que toma una cadena. Ambos métodos podrían tener el mismo nombre, pero tendrían firmas diferentes. ¿Qué es la sobrecarga de constructores? La sobrecarga de constructores es una característica de algunos lenguajes de programación que permite a una clase tener múltiples constructores que toman diferentes argumentos. Esto puede ser útil cuando una clase puede ser inicializada de múltiples maneras, como con diferentes cantidades o tipos de datos.
¿Qué es la sobrecarga en C++? La sobrecarga en C++ se refiere a la capacidad de crear múltiples funciones con el mismo nombre, siempre y cuando tengan diferentes firmas. Puedes usar esto para crear diferentes funcionalidades dependiendo de los parámetros de entrada. Podrías, por ejemplo, crear una función de sobrecarga que reaccione de manera diferente a los parámetros de entrada de int y double.